Questions this course answers

Who sends David aboard the Covenant?

Ebenezer arranges the voyage with Captain Hoseason to get David out of the way.

Why are David and Alan hunted?

The killing of Colin Campbell, the Red Fox, becomes the basis for a broad pursuit.

What is the central contrast between David and Alan?

Their different temperaments make their partnership both effective and argumentative.

What does the title mean beyond the literal abduction?

The novel links family betrayal and forced transport to the problem of who has power to define David’s experience.

What does David become by the end?

His education is moral and interpretive as well as physical: he learns how to judge power and loyalty.
